Well, today was a pretty bad day where I wanted to make much more than on the previous days. Thought, I should make at least 1.5k to 2k profits and I traded bigger and scaled in instead of sticking to my small SL of 8T. So I lost about 2.7k...well I'm still in the game and didn't break any rules but it will be hard to climb out of the hole. Anyways on my live account I did much better and could afford a couple resets on the combine .
However, that's not the goal and I need to trade according to plan and don't just think it is a sim account. It is a bit harder when it's just "Sim" as I tend to go way too big if I'm losing and have way too small winners...
Anyways, my last CL trade was stopped out and then it finally started the retracement lower what I expected after a steady 3 days of just going up but my stop level was not good as normally the 50.50 (half even numbers always provide some initial resistance) bc my postion was too big and I couldn't afford to have my stop like at 50.53/55 as I would've hit my daily loss limit, also I was onside with this last trade like $500 but I wanted to make my earlier losses of 1.6k back with just one trade. This is stupid because it was clearly a counter trend trade and I should've just booked 400-500 bucks and reenter short higher...oh well

Just wanted to say thanks for posting your journal with all the ups and downs . And I wanted to encourage you as aquarian has to keep at it there's a pot-o-gold at the end of the journey I also liked what Hannake said when she said to allow yourself more time to achieve the goal. I have come to realize that it's not how fast I get there but how well I trade each moment of each day that brings success. While I dreamed of finishing my combine in 10 days, in reality it's possible, but unlikely and I have learned that when I focus on either needing to make $XXXX or that I lost $XXXX I make many execution mistakes from either fear or greed. I like many others am still a work in progress but have found more success as I focus more on executing like a professional and less on the $.
Thanks again for the time you put into your journal, and good luck on your journey, we are all in this struggle together, and as long as we're learning each day and working hard to achieve our goal we will get there!
